Output 80c9c4c86c61dd3d7f003b6fc4e4afdc75732ca09d4d9cf4efaee573517d4019:0

value
25731611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173bc14cb9b6b1e41f1dc8deba26563ca4d071c1 OP_EQUAL
address
MA21MhRjRnqnpfwzoyBLF1WzNALLk3JaoD
transaction
80c9c4c86c61dd3d7f003b6fc4e4afdc75732ca09d4d9cf4efaee573517d4019
spent
true